What is MP3?
Developed by Fraunhofer Society in 1993, MP3 revolutionized music distribution by enabling efficient lossy compression. It uses perceptual coding to discard audio frequencies less audible to human ears, achieving compression ratios of roughly 10:1. Typical bitrates range from 128 to 320 kbps, and it remains the most universally compatible audio format across all devices and platforms.
What is FLAC?
Released in 2001, FLAC is a free, open-source lossless audio codec that typically compresses audio to 50-60% of the original size without losing a single bit of data. Unlike MP3 or AAC, FLAC decodes to a bit-perfect copy of the original recording. It is the preferred format for audiophiles, music archivists, and Hi-Fi streaming services like Tidal and Qobuz.
Why Convert MP3 to FLAC?
Converting MP3 to FLAC is useful when you need a lossless container for archival purposes or compatibility with Hi-Fi audio systems that only accept lossless formats. While this conversion cannot restore audio data discarded during MP3 compression, it ensures no further quality loss during storage or future conversions. This is common when integrating MP3 files into a lossless music library managed by tools like Plex or Roon.
Key Differences Between MP3 and FLAC
MP3 (MPEG Audio Layer III) is a lossy format, while FLAC (Free Lossless Audio Codec) is a lossless format. MP3 files are typically smaller due to compression, whereas FLAC files are larger but maintain perfect fidelity.
